The Confessions of Jean-Jacques Rousseau” is a groundbreaking memoir by the influential Enlightenment philosopher, offering a candid exploration of his life and ideas. This autobiography diverges from earlier religious-focused memoirs, focusing instead on Rousseau’s personal experiences and emotions. Covering his life until 1765, it presents both inspiring and controversial aspects of his life, including personal wrongdoings and his abandonment of five children. Completed in 1769 but published posthumously in 1782, this work inspired a new genre of introspective and honest autobiographies.

 

Beautifully bound in red Moroccan leather, this two-volume 1928 edition was translated into English from the French by W. Conyngham Mallory and is ornamented with 13 original engravings from the “Jouaust Edition” of 1881 by Edmond Hédouin.
